Regulatory Risks Associated with the H2O DAO (H2O) Coin

Key Points:

  • H2O is an ERC-20 token that powers the H2O DAO ecosystem, a decentralized platform for water management.
  • The regulatory risks associated with H2O stem from its classification as a security by the SEC.
  • Legal experts recommend that companies seek legal counsel to ensure compliance with regulatory requirements.

1. Classification as a Security

The SEC's classification of H2O as a security subjects it to federal securities laws and regulations. This means that any issuance, sale, or distribution of H2O must comply with these laws, which include registration requirements, financial reporting obligations, and anti-fraud provisions.

2. Registration Requirements

Companies issuing securities must register the offering with the SEC unless an exemption applies. Exemptions are available in limited circumstances, such as private placements to accredited investors. However, qualifying for an exemption can be complex and requires careful legal analysis.

3. Financial Reporting Obligations

Companies with registered securities must file periodic financial reports with the SEC. These reports disclose information about the company's financial performance, operations, and financial condition. Failure to file accurate and timely reports can result in regulatory penalties.

4. Anti-Fraud Provisions

Securities laws prohibit fraudulent or misleading statements in connection with the sale of securities. This includes making false or exaggerated claims about the company or its products. Violating anti-fraud provisions can lead to civil lawsuits and criminal charges.

5. Enforcement Actions

The SEC and other regulatory agencies have the authority to enforce securities laws and bring legal actions against companies that violate these laws. Enforcement actions can result in fines, injunctions, and other remedies.

6. Penalties for Non-Compliance

Companies that fail to comply with securities laws can face significant penalties. These penalties include fines, disgorgement of profits, and restrictions on future offerings. In severe cases, company executives can face criminal charges.

FAQs

Q: What is the difference between a security and a utility token?

A: A security is a financial instrument that represents an investment in a company. It typically provides holders with ownership rights or profit-sharing. A utility token, on the other hand, is used to access a specific product or service. It does not grant ownership rights or profit-sharing.

Q: How do companies avoid classifying their tokens as securities?

A: Companies can avoid classifying their tokens as securities by structuring them in a way that emphasizes their use as a utility token. This includes limiting the token's investment potential and ensuring that it has a specific use case within the platform's ecosystem.
